#~ 将每一行转换成numpy.array数组 #~ 返回numpy.array数组的列表 #~ 注意:每一行的数组中的元素个数可以不一样 """ from StringIO import StringIO import re,numpy file=open(Filename, 'r') String = file.read() file.close() NumList=[] StringList=String.split('\n')#使用换行符分割字符串 Li...
在这篇文章中,我将教你如何使用Python编程语言读取文本文件,并使用numpy库对文件中的数据进行处理。Python是一种简单易用的编程语言,而numpy是一个功能强大的数值计算库,可以帮助我们更方便地处理大规模的数据。 2. 读取txt文件的流程 在开始之前,让我们先来了解一下读取txt文件的整个流程。下面的表格展示了读取txt...
data= []forlineinopen("data.txt","r"): #设置文件对象并读取每一行文件data.append(line) #将每一行文件加入到list中 第三种方法 f = open("data.txt","r")#设置文件对象data = f.readlines()#直接将文件中按行读到list里,效果与方法2一样f.close()#关闭文件 3.将文件读入数组中 importnumpyasnp...
df = pd.read_csv('example.txt', delimiter='t') print("File content using pandas:") print(df.head()) 使用numpy读取数值数据 data = np.loadtxt('example.txt', delimiter=',') print("File content using numpy:") print(data) 五、处理读取的txt文件内容 在读取txt文件内容后,通常需要进一步处理...
(1)对文件名进行打印,检查是否缺少和乱序 import pandas as pd import numpy as np import xlwt ...
>>> f.read() ‘hello python!\nhello world!\n’ >>> f.close() 读取数据是后期数据处理的必要步骤。.txt是广泛使用的数据文件格式。一些.csv, .xlsx等文件可以转换为.txt 文件进行读取。我常使用的是Python自带的I/O接口,将数据读取进来存放在list中,然后再用numpy科学计算包将list的数据转换为array格式...
下面是一个使用 Python 读取 txt 文件并对其中的文本内容进行分析和处理的实际案例。 import numpy as np import pandas as pd # 读取 txt 文件中的文本内容 with open('example.txt', 'r') as file: text = file.read() # 使用 numpy 对文本内容进行分析和处理 data = np.fromstring(text, dtype='st...
首先python内置了csv库,可以调用然后自己手动来写操作的代码,比较简单的csv文件读取载入到数组可以采用python的pandas库中的read_csv()函数来读取。其中函数的具体参数很长,在此忽略,详细参考专业api文档。这里代码实现及结果如下所示: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 import numpy as np import ...
读操作使用pandas.read_csv,写操作使用data.to_csv。 importnumpyimportpandasaspd#读data = pd.read_csv(r"/home/snowstorm/mmdetection/data/groundtruth.txt", header=None)#读取TXT:逗号分隔#data = pd.read_csv(r"/home/snowstorm/mmdetection/data/groundtruth.txt", header=None, sep=' ') #读取TXT:...
在这个例子中,我们使用Pandas的read_csv()函数读取了一个名为data.txt的TXT文件,其中的数据以制表符分隔。然后我们打印了数据的前五行,以及每个元素出现的频率。您可以根据需要对这个代码进行修改,以适应您的特定需求。2. NumPy库NumPy是一个流行的Python库,用于处理大型多维数组和矩阵。它还提供了一些强大的函数和...